Galaxy A71 5G is better than Galaxy A30s, having a general score of 91.8 against 79.8. Both of these phones use the same Android 11 OS (Operating System). Galaxy A71 5G's construction is newer, but a little thicker and somewhat heavier than Galaxy A30s. Galaxy A71 5G counts with a more vivid screen than Galaxy A30s, because it has a bit bigger screen, more pixels per inch of display and a way better resolution of 1080 x 2400px.
The Samsung Galaxy A71 5G features a little bit better storage for games and applications than Samsung Galaxy A30s, and although they both have equal 128 GB internal storage capacity, the Samsung Galaxy A71 5G also has a SD extension slot that admits up to 1000 GB. The Samsung Galaxy A71 5G counts with a little better performance than Samsung Galaxy A30s, and although they both have the same number of cores, the Samsung Galaxy A71 5G also has a higher amount of RAM.
Galaxy A71 5G has a lot better camera than Samsung Galaxy A30s, because although it has a tinier camera aperture which is not so good for low-light photos and videos, it also counts with a lot higher video quality and a lot better 64 megapixels resolution camera in the back. Galaxy A71 5G counts with just a little bit longer battery lifetime than Galaxy A30s, because it has a 13% larger battery size.
